Demonstrations and Discussions:

Anthony Martocello will be discussing and demonstrating some VMWare Solutions
that the Northport-East Northport Library has put in place.

Stephen Ingram will talk about the Northport-East Northport Library
website (www.nenpl.org) and how Anthony Martocello developed a PHP
back-end system that allows select staff members to update events,
weblinks, new items lists and database information dynamically with a
simple interface and no html programing skill (a little helps though).

The Northport-East Northport Library also has a HP Designjet Z5200
printer which is used in-house to print posters ranging in width from
24 to 44 inches to whatever length.

We will also be discussing and demonstrating some updated Web-based OS solutions

CATS Library Conference Presentation 2011

Mobile Technology – Keeping Up in a Fast Paced World

Speakers: Bob Johnson, Port Jefferson Free Library and Michael Berse, Mobile App Developer/Programmer

Description: Everything mobile!  Everything now!  Mobile services, instant communication and access to information are demanding services we must provide.  Find new and innovative ways to reach your target users.  Program will include a full demonstration of the new Suffolk Mobile Library Application for Smart Phones.
